Online Platforms And Marketplaces

  • Popular Online Platforms: Explore plat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, Freelancer, and 99designs to find freelance graphic design projects.
  • Create a Successful Profile: Craft a compelling profile that highlights your skills, experience, and portfolio. Use keywords relevant to your niche to increase your visibility in search results.
  • Strategies for Bidding on Projects: Research project requirements carefully, submit competitive bids, and provide clear and concise proposals to increase your chances of winning clients.

Freelance Job Boards And Websites

  • Specialized Freelance Job Boards: Utilize specialized freelance job boards like DesignCrowd, Designhill, and Guru to find freelance graphic design projects.
  • Websites Offering Freelance Projects: Explore websites like Creative Market, Etsy, and Shutterstock that offer freelance graphic design projects and opportunities.
  • Tips for Finding Legitimate Opportunities: Be cautious of scams and fraudulent job postings. Research potential clients thoroughly and read reviews and testimonials before committing to a project.
